LINDENHURST U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T

District Overview
Situated at 350 Daniel Street in Lindenhurst, New York, the Lindenhurst Union Free School District operates as an active, traditional public school system within a large suburban setting of the New York-Newark-Jersey City metropolitan area. The district oversees eight operational schools that deliver a complete educational pathway spanning from prekindergarten through 12th grade, along with ungraded educational programs. Currently educating 5,635 students across its elementary, middle, and high school grade levels, the district serves as a central educational hub for its local community.

A comprehensive workforce supports the district’s academic and operational needs, totaling approximately 1,924 full-time equivalent staff members. This team includes 1,018 full-time equivalent classroom teachers, working alongside 83 instructional aides and 823 support staff personnel to maintain school operations and student services.
